摘要
为了克服能见度不良及“海上光污染”等对船舶号灯可识别性的影响,提出利用甚高频(VHF)通信技术将传统号灯直线传播的灯光信号改变为借助于VHF电台进行收发;介绍了基于VHF通信的船舶号灯信号收发系统的原理、组成及编码协议;并在MATLAB环境中对该系统的收发过程进行了数字仿真,仿真效果比较理想.
In order to overcome the bad influences of the restricted visibility and "light pollution at sea" on the identification of the ship lights, a way of changing the ship lights' radiation in a beeline into transmission based on very high frequency (VHF) radio communication was put forward. The principle, composing and coding agreements of the transceiver system of the ship lights were introduced; Moreover, the digital simulation of the system's transmitting and receiving process was done in MATLAB, the simulation result was acceptable.
